Crawford Place, London.
The Larrick is a pub where customers can enjoy a varied selection of drinks and food. Based in Crawford Place, London, The Larrick is bar.
The Larrick are listed in the bar section here:
Tell London about your experience of The Larrick...
Now displaying reviews 1 - 1
We are based in an office around the corner from the larrick and we love it! The burger is an old fa... More »
View the complete list of The Larrick reviews »
The Larrick is in Crawford Place London. You can view a list of neighbouring businesses by going to the page.
If you would like a list of other public houses, bars & inns shops & other retail outlets listings throughout London, please visit the section of this website.
More places in or near Crawford Place...